Jeremiah,

You were essentially correct. A "targeted" MR does not have to search
for the data, and does not slow down with database size. It is a
bucket-sweeping MR that currently has that behavior.

>>> I use PB erlang interface to access the database.  Given a bucket name
>>> and a key, the value can easily be extracted using:
>>>
>>>     {ok, Object} = riakc_pb_socket:get(Conn, Bucket, Key),
>>>     Value = riakc_obj:get_value(Object)
>>>
>>> Alternatively, a mapred (actually, just map) request could be issued:
>>>
>>>     {ok, [{_, Value}]} = riakc_pb_socket:mapred(Conn, [
>>>         {Bucket, Key}
>>>     ], [
>>>         {map, {modfun, riak_kv, map_object_value}, none, true}
>>>     ])
>>>
>>> I would expect that the result is the same while in the second case, the
>>> amount of data transferred to the client is smaller (which might be good
>>> for certain situations).
>>>
>>> So the [open] question is: are there any reasons for using the first
>>> approach over the second?
